2) At a restaurante, what percent tip is included on the bill?
A) 15%B) 18%C) 10%
Incorrect, Try Again!
Correct!
Most restaurants in Peru include a 10% gratuity on the bill. You add an extra 10% if the service has been satisfactory. It is true that the people of Peru are not big tippers, but tipping is a great way to show your appreciation.
